Method of and system for storing, communicating, and displaying image data
First Claim
Patent Images
1. A method of rendering an image of a multidimensional item, the rendering occurring at one of a server and a client, the server and the client in communication with a network, the method comprising:
- storing a data file at the server, the data file including image data that is constructable to form the multidimensional item, wherein at least some of the image data is structured as submatrices satisfying the equation
13 Assignments
0 Petitions
Accused Products
Abstract
A system for storing, communicating, and displaying image or graphic data over a network. The system includes a client that is connectable to a server via a network. The server is configured to store an image file having image data, where the structure of the image file preferably includes submatrices. The submatrices allow the system to render the images using an adaptive rendering technique.
43 Citations
44 Claims
-
1. A method of rendering an image of a multidimensional item, the rendering occurring at one of a server and a client, the server and the client in communication with a network, the method comprising:
storing a data file at the server, the data file including image data that is constructable to form the multidimensional item, wherein at least some of the image data is structured as submatrices satisfying the equation -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14)
-
15. A method of displaying images of a multidimensional item at a client, the multidimensional item being stored as a data file at a server, the data file including image data constructable to form the multidimensional item, the method comprising:
-
receiving a request for a first image; communicating a first portion of the image data to the client, the first portion of the image data including data for displaying the first image; storing the first portion of the image data at the client, the storing of the image data resulting in stored data, wherein at least some of the image data is structured as submatrices satisfying the equation - View Dependent Claims (16, 17, 18, 19, 20, 21, 22)
-
-
23. A method of communicating image data to a client for displaying images of an item, the method comprising:
-
providing an image file having image data; storing the provided image file at a server, the stored image file including the image data structured as submatrices, wherein at least some of the submatrices satisfy the equation - View Dependent Claims (24, 25, 26, 27, 28, 29, 30, 31, 32, 33)
-
-
34. A method of displaying images of a three-dimensional item, the three dimensional item being stored at a server as an image file having image data, the image data structured with submatrices, the method comprising:
-
receiving a first plurality of the submatrices from the server; storing the first plurality of submatrices, the storing of the submatrices resulting in stored submatrices, wherein at least same of the submatrices satisfy the equation - View Dependent Claims (35, 36, 37, 38, 39, 40)
-
-
41. A method of storing an image file in memory, the method comprising:
-
receiving a three-dimensional image file by the server having image data representing a three-dimensional item; structuring the received image file using submatrices, wherein at least some of the submatrices satisfy the equation - View Dependent Claims (42, 43, 44)
-
Specification